| Monsieur Pierre Dubost, a professional in cutlery, who was himself a cutler's son, founded Dubost Colas Pradel in 1920. They started in a small workshop but rapidly grew under the inspiration of Jean Dubost, the founder's son. The bumblebee that is found on all the Laguiole knives is one of the emblems of the area, signifying its reliability The blade, made of high-grade stainless steel, is stamped, then ground and then polished with over 25 different manual production stages.
